How much do no experience marketing j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for no experience marketing in Riverside, CA is $34.10,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$22.55 and $45.14 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a no experience marketing job?

'No Experience Marketing' jobs are entry-level roles in the marketing industry that do not require prior marketing experience. These positions are designed for individuals new to the field and often focus on basic tasks such as social media posting, market research, content creation, or assisting with campaigns. Employers typically provide on-the-job training and look for candidates with strong communication skills, creativity, and a willingness to learn. These roles can be a great way to start a career in marketing and gain valuable industry experience.

What skills and qualifications are needed for an entry-level marketing role with no prior experience?

To thrive in an entry-level marketing role with no prior experience, you need a basic understanding of marketing principles, strong writing skills, and a willingness to learn. Familiarity with tools such as social media platforms, email marketing software (like Mailchimp), and basic analytics (like Google Analytics) is beneficial. Creativity, adaptability, and effective communication are standout soft skills that help you contribute to campaigns and collaborate with team members. These skills and qualities are crucial for quickly adapting to the fast-paced marketing environment and delivering impactful results as you build your expertise.

How can entry-level marketing professionals with no prior experience contribute to a marketing team?

Entry-level marketing professionals can make a significant impact by bringing fresh perspectives and a willingness to learn new tools and strategies. They often assist with tasks like content creation, social media management, market research, and campaign support, all of which are vital to a team's success. Taking initiative to learn about the company’s brand, actively participating in brainstorming sessions, and volunteering for cross-functional projects can also help build valuable skills and demonstrate enthusiasm. Collaboration with experienced marketers and openness to feedback are key to growing quickly in the field.

How can I start a career in no experience marketing with no experience?

Starting a career in no experience marketing involves gaining basic knowledge of marketing principles through online courses or tutorials, building a portfolio with personal projects or internships, and developing skills in tools like social media platforms, email marketing, or analytics. Entry-level roles often focus on learning and adaptability, so demonstrating enthusiasm and a willingness to learn is important.

How to find a job in marketing with no experience?

To find a marketing job with no experience, focus on building relevant skills such as social media management, content creation, or data analysis through online courses or certifications. Volunteer for local projects or internships to gain practical experience and create a strong portfolio to demonstrate your abilities to employers.
